Tamper-resistant fastener

DWPI Title: Tamper-resistant fastener for physical security application to delay adversary during attack of asset, has cap element that is not removable from slot in direction away from threaded fastener along first longitudinal axis of fastener
Abstract: A tamper-resistant threaded fastener including a circular head having a slot formed in the head transverse to the longitudinal axis, the slot having an enlarged region intermediate an apex and a base of the slot. A cap member includes a head having a drive feature formed therein, the head extending to a first shank portion, extending to an enlarged second shank portion, extending to a foot. The cap member is insertable in the slot only from a direction transverse to the longitudinal axis. During rotational installation of the fastener and cap member in a threaded counterbored opening for securing a barrier for protecting an asset, the foot shears inside the slot at a predetermined rotational drive force, the cap member being rotatable in the opening and protectively covering the fastener head.
Use: The fastener for providing tamper-resistance protection for an asset.
Advantage: The fastener makes removal of the fastener more difficult and time-consuming.
Novelty: The fastener has an enlarged second shank portion that is receivable in an enlarged region. A foot is receivable in a slot between the enlarged region and a base. The foot abutting the slot and preventing a rotation of a cap element relative to the slot for urging a threaded fastener to threadedly engage a threaded counterbored opening until an end portion shearing at a predetermined rotational drive force in response to insertion of the cap element in the slot of the threaded fastener and a shank of the threaded fastener alignedly positioned in the threaded counterbored opening for securing a barrier for protecting an asset and application of a rotational drive force to a drive feature of the cap element. The cap element is rotatable in the threaded counterbored opening and protectively covering a head of the threaded fastener. The cap element is not removable from the slot in a direction away from the threaded fastener along a first longitudinal axis of the threaded fastener.
